Just a reminder — this event is NOT automatically tracked / scored.  You MUST click the tracker "button" that appears at the top of the profile after you have saved your edits, and before you leave the profile.

Once having clicked the Challenge Tracker, select the Source-a-Thon checkbox, if it's not already automatically selected.
Remember, too, it doesn't matter if you add one source, or twenty sources, the edit only counts once — even if you make multiple edits to add extra sources.

                            One profile = one point.
